What the scan found

The scan found that Orca has a trustScore of 90, which corresponds to a trustGrade of AAA. The scam probability is relatively low at 10%. The honeypot signal is false, indicating that the token does not have a honeypot trap. There are no taxes on buying or selling the token. The contract is mintable but not freezable, and ownership has not been renounced. The contract has been verified. The liquidity is $850,574, with no liquidity locked. There are 89,799 holders, but the top 10 holders control 61% of the supply.
